Nigeria cannot build sustainable security without an understanding of of today's insecurity and implementation of "deep-rooted security and political reforms", Presidential aspirant Kingsley Moghalu told the annual gathering of the Nigerians in the Diaspora Organisation (NIDOA). Moghalu, a former depiuty governor of the Central Bank who also ran for president in 2019, said "Nigerians abroad should invest to install a government that your children can be proud to call home."
